CASTLEGATE. Craig Barrowman

14 February - 28 March

Opening Friday 13 February 6-8pm. With performance by Ruaraidh Sanachan.

Aberdeen’s Castlegate is a historic market square through which thousands of Aberdonians pass daily to and from the beach, harbour and city centre. In the narrow alleyways surrounding the square you can find giant reptiles, early opening ale-houses, music, seagulls, religion and art. Local artist Craig Barrowman brings together different experiences and elements of this truly unique civic square. The show includes photographs, sound, and interactions with the inhabitants of this colourful part of the city.
